在当今互联网世界中,网络安全和隐私越来越受到关注。为了保护个人隐私和安全,许多人开始使用不同的网络工具,如代理服务器、VPN和Shadowsocks。但这三者到底有什么区别呢?在本文中,我们将深入探讨代理服务器、VPN和Shadowsocks之间的区别、各自的优缺点以及适用场景。
一、代理服务器是什么?
代理服务器是一个中间服务器,用户的请求通过该服务器转发到目标网站。简单来说,用户通过代理服务器访问互联网,从而隐藏其真实IP地址。代理服务器常见的类型包括:
- 正向代理
- 反向代理
- 透明代理
1.1 正向代理
正向代理通常是用户自己控制的代理,它主要用于绕过网络限制或过滤。比如,在学校或公司中,使用正向代理可以访问被屏蔽的网站。
1.2 反向代理
反向代理则是代理服务器位于互联网和用户之间,用于分担流量、加速访问和隐藏真实服务器信息。常用于大规模网站。
1.3 透明代理
透明代理不会改变用户的请求,也不会隐藏用户的IP地址。它常用于缓存和过滤内容。
二、VPN是什么?
VPN(虚拟私人网络)是一种网络技术,它通过公共互联网为用户创建一个加密的私人网络。VPN能有效保护用户的在线隐私和安全。使用VPN后,用户的网络流量被加密,任何第三方都无法窃取信息。常见的VPN协议包括:
- PPTP
- L2TP
- OpenVPN
2.1 VPN的优点
- 增强安全性:VPN通过加密保护用户数据,防止被窃取。
- 匿名性:VPN可以隐藏用户真实IP,提高在线匿名性。
- 绕过地域限制:用户可以通过连接不同国家的服务器访问被限制的网站。
2.2 VPN的缺点
- 速度降低:由于加密和数据传输过程,使用VPN可能导致网速下降。
- 不一定安全:某些免费的VPN服务可能不够安全,甚至会记录用户活动。
三、Shadowsocks是什么?
Shadowsocks是一种代理工具,常用于绕过互联网审查。它的设计初衷是为了提高用户的网络速度和安全性。Shadowsocks的核心在于其基于SOCKS5协议的特点,通过加密和混淆来隐藏网络流量。
3.1 Shadowsocks的优点
- 高性能:相较于传统的VPN,Shadowsocks通常提供更快的速度。
- 灵活性:可以配置多个代理节点,方便用户选择。
- 简单易用:配置和使用相对简单,适合技术水平不同的用户。
3.2 Shadowsocks的缺点
- 安全性较低:虽然Shadowsocks使用加密,但与全面的VPN安全性相比可能仍有差距。
- 仅支持TCP和UDP:Shadowsocks对某些类型的流量(如VoIP)支持不如VPN。
四、代理服务器、VPN与Shadowsocks的对比
在对比代理服务器、VPN和Shadowsocks时,可以从以下几个方面来考虑:
4.1 安全性
- VPN > Shadowsocks > 代理服务器
- VPN通过加密提供最强的安全性,Shadowsocks使用的加密较弱,代理服务器则没有加密保护。
4.2 速度
- Shadowsocks > VPN > 代理服务器
- Shadowsocks通常提供最快的速度,VPN在加密的过程中可能会减慢速度,而某些代理服务器由于配置或网络限制可能速度不佳。
4.3 匿名性
- VPN > Shadowsocks > 代理服务器
- VPN最能保护用户匿名,Shadowsocks虽然隐匿流量,但仍有一定风险,代理服务器基本不能保证匿名。
4.4 使用场景
- 代理服务器适合绕过简单的地域限制;
- VPN适合需要高安全性和匿名性用户;
- Shadowsocks适合网络速度要求高的用户。
五、常见问题解答
5.1 代理服务器、VPN和Shadowsocks哪个更好?
没有绝对的答案,主要取决于用户的需求。对于需要高安全性的用户,VPN更合适;对于注重速度和灵活性的用户,Shadowsocks可能更适合;而对只需简单代理功能的用户,普通代理服务器就足够了。
5.2 使用VPN是否完全安全?
虽然VPN提供了一定的安全保护,但并非绝对安全。选择可靠的VPN提供商至关重要,免费VPN往往风险较高。
5.3 Shadowsocks与VPN的最大区别是什么?
Shadowsocks主要用于隐匿和快速访问被屏蔽网站,而VPN则更注重安全和隐私保护。
5.4 代理服务器可以替代VPN吗?
在某些情况下可以,但代理服务器通常没有加密保护,因此在处理敏感信息时不如VPN安全。
结论
通过对代理服务器、VPN和Shadowsocks的分析,我们可以发现三者各有优缺点,适用于不同的使用场景。用户在选择时,应根据自身的需求进行选择,才能更好地保护个人隐私和数据安全。希望本文能够帮助您理解这三者的区别。